Untreated Decks – Can I leave my deck untreated?

There isn’t any law that untreated decks must be treated with paint, sealer, or stain, but professionals advise that you won’t get as long of a lifespan if it isn’t treated. A wood deck that is properly sealed and treated, and regular deck maintenance, can give you up to 50 years of beauty and enjoyment. An untreated wooden deck will only give you 10 to 15 years, depending on the climate.

Untreated Decks – How often do decks need to be sealed?

With a solid stain, you want to reapply every four to five years. A sealer doesn’t color the wood, simply protects it from the moisture and minimizes the wood from rotting and splitting. Resealing every season should be a part of your routine deck maintenance.

Should I stain or seal my untreated decks?

Maybe you don’t have untreated decks currently, so deck maintenance isn’t an issue yet. Your deck plans are building one or having one built, so you want to get started right. Is staining or sealing a wood deck the best way to start?

The most common recommend by professional contractors is to use a combination stain and sealer, which is a wood sealer that has color pigment added to provide the stain results. This combination provides an advantage of added protection from water and weather damaging the wood. The stain part of the combination product minimizing the UV rays to keep the color from fading. Applied correctly, your deck maintenance will be easier.
